Maintaining your V blender is essential for its longevity. Start by cleaning the blades immediately after each use. Food residues left too long can harden, making cleaning more challenging. Use warm soapy water to wash the jar and blades. Rinse thoroughly to prevent soap residue in your next blend. Also, avoid immersing the base in water; it might damage the motor.
Regularly check the rubber gasket around the jar. If it appears worn or cracked, replace it. A damaged gasket can lead to leaks, which can be messy. Store the blender in a dry place to prevent moisture accumulation. Keep the cord untangled and avoid pulling it during use.
While it’s easy to overlook these details, neglecting them can reduce the blender’s performance. Sometimes, a simple misalignment of the jar can cause issues. Pay attention to sounds while blending; unusual noises might indicate a problem. Reflecting on these maintenance steps regularly can enhance your blending experience.

In the pharmaceutical industry, the efficiency of material mixing is critical. Vertical ribbon blenders have emerged as a solution that optimizes mixing performance while addressing space constraints often found in production environments. The unique vertical design of these blenders effectively minimizes the footprint, making them particularly advantageous for facilities with limited floor space. This innovative structure allows for a more effective integration of equipment within compact areas, ensuring that operational efficiency is maximized without compromising on the quality of the mixing process.
The screw elevator feature of vertical ribbon blenders enhances the blending process by lifting materials vertically, facilitating cross-blending. This method not only ensures a uniform mixture but also improves the overall mixing speed and consistency, which are essential in pharmaceutical applications where precision is paramount. By efficiently moving materials throughout the blending chamber, these blenders create a more homogeneous product while further optimizing resource use and reducing processing times. The design and function of vertical ribbon blenders truly cater to the specialized needs within the pharmaceutical sector, making them an invaluable tool in modern manufacturing processes.
